In editorial design, Helvetica LT Pro Bold is often reserved for headlines, subheadings, and pull quotes. It creates a strong structural hierarchy. On the web, it is frequently used for navigation menus and buttons, where clear, bold text indicates interactivity. helvetica lt pro bold
